Social Work Internship Foster Care Internship:Columbus, OH
National Youth Advocate Program is accepting internship applications for the Summer, 2026 and Fall, 2026 to our Foster Care team. In this role you will get hands on experience working with the foster care population. You will also have the opportunity to observe other therapeutic areas throughout the agency to gain insight to the communities and clients we serve. This position works closely with youth, family, foster parents, and community partners.
This opportunity is for students enrolled in a Bachelor
-or
- Master of Social Work Program from an accredited College or University.
- Working with foster care youth and foster parents
- Working in case management
- Learning diagnostics assessments and treatment plans
- Assessing and engaging with youth
- Observing interventions for youth
- Interacting with caregivers, parents, foster parents, school staff, office staff and other mental health professionals
- Learning documentation and paperwork.
- Traveling daily, to provide community-based services to youth and families.
- Interacting with caregivers, parents, foster parents, school staff, office staff and other mental health professionals
- Must be enrolled in either a Bachelor of Social Work or Master of Social Work Program from an accredited College or University
- An internship or field placement is a requirement by the institution.
- Upon the completion of the internship, the individual would receive credit toward their pursued degree.
- Must be 21 years of age at the start of the internship
- LSW or SWT licensure required for master’s interns
- Proficient use of desktop and laptop computers, smart phones and tablets, as well as software including word processing, spreadsheet and database programs.
- Valid driver’s license
- Reliable personal transportation
- Good driving record
- Minimum automobile insurance coverage of $100,000/$300,000 bodily injury liability
